Operating System Notes ---------------------- 'ulimit -s unlimited' was used to set environment stack size limit 'ulimit -l 2097152' was used to set environment locked pages in memory limit runcpu command invoked through numactl i.e.: numactl --interleave=all runcpu To limit dirty cache to 8% of memory, 'sysctl -w vm.dirty_ratio=8' run as root. To limit swap usage to minimum necessary, 'sysctl -w vm.swappiness=1' run as root. To free node-local memory and avoid remote memory usage, 'sysctl -w vm.zone_reclaim_mode=1' run as root. To clear filesystem caches, 'sync; sysctl -w vm.drop_caches=3' run as root. To disable address space layout randomization (ASLR) to reduce run-to-run variability, 'sysctl -w kernel.randomize_va_space=0' run as root. To enable Transparent Hugepages (THP) for all allocations, 'echo always > /sys/kernel/mm/transparent_hugepage/enabled' and 'echo always > /sys/kernel/mm/transparent_hugepage/defrag' run as root.
